Peanut Butter Cottage Cheese Mousse


This peanut butter cottage cheese mousse is a sweet, creamy, high-protein treat with rich peanut butter flavor and a light, fluffy texture!

This peanut butter cottage cheese mousse is sweet, creamy, and packed with rich peanut butter flavor. Made with sugar-free peanut butter, low-fat cottage cheese, sugar-free sweetener, and sugar-free whipped cream, itโ€™s an indulgent treat without the guilt. In fact, this might just be our new favorite cottage cheese mousse!

And donโ€™t worry, you donโ€™t need to be a fan of cottage cheese to love this dessert. The texture is smooth, light, and creamy, with just a subtle tang that enhances the peanut butter flavor.

We blend whipped cottage cheese with sugar-free peanut butter for a bold, nutty taste and fold in sugar-free whipped cream for a fluffy, mousse-like texture.

The best part? Itโ€™s made with just four simple ingredients and comes together in about five minutes. You can also top it off with your favorite add-ons like chopped nuts, sugar-free whipped cream, or even a sprinkle of dark chocolate for extra decadence.

Ingredients

Cottage cheese:ย We use a low-fat cottage cheese (2% milkfat) in this bowl since it slightly increases the protein, and we found little difference in taste between the low- and high-fat cottage cheese when done.

Sugar-free peanut butter: We useย Santa Cruz Organic Light Roasted Creamy Peanut Butterย since it has no added sugar. However, you could use another sugar-free peanut butter of choice. If not at room temperature, be sure to soften the peanut butter in the microwave before combining with the rest of the ingredients.

Sugar-free Whipping Cream: To enhance the flavor and make the mousse lighter, we incorporate zero-sugar whipping cream. We simply use store-bought zero-sugar whipping cream since it’s tasty and low in carbs.

STEP-BY-STEP INSTRUCTIONS

Step 1: In a food processor, blend the cottage cheese until completely smooth. In a small bowl, microwave the sugar-free peanut butter in 15-second intervals until soft and easily to stir.

Step 2: Add the melted peanut butter to the food processor and blend until fully incorporated with the whipped cottage cheese.

Step 3: Transfer the mixture to a medium bowl and gently fold in the sugar-free whipped cream with a spatula until light and fluffy. Topped with crushed sugar-free chocolate chips if desired.

How to Store

This mousse is best enjoyed fresh, but it will stay creamy and delicious for a few days. Store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 2 days. For the best texture, stir before serving or fold in a little extra whipped cream.

Recipe

Peanut Butter Cottage Cheese Mousse

Low-Carb Simplified

This peanut butter cottage cheese mousse is a sweet, creamy, high-protein treat with rich peanut butter flavor and a light, fluffy texture!

Prep Time 5 minutes

Total Time 5 minutes

Course Dessert

Cuisine American

Servings 1

Calories 310 kcal

Instructionsย 

  • Prepare ingredients: In a food processor, blend the cottage cheese until completely smooth. In a small bowl, microwave the sugar-free peanut butter in 15-second intervals until soft and easily to stir.

  • Combine: Add the melted peanut butter to the food processor and blend until fully incorporated with the whipped cottage cheese.

  • Finish and serve: Transfer the mixture to a medium bowl and gently fold in the sugar-free whipped cream with a spatula until light and fluffy. Topped with crushed sugar-free chocolate chips if desired.

Nutrition

Calories: 310kcalCarbohydrates: 14gProtein: 22gFat: 22.5gSaturated Fat: 6.5gCholesterol: 35mgSodium: 390mgFiber: 3gSugar: 4gSugar Alcohols: 6gNet Carbs: 5gProtein Percentage: 28%
